What is the HubSpot connector in Spotler Connect?

The HubSpot connector connects your HubSpot environment with Spotler Connect to exchange customer data between systems. It keeps records aligned by synchronizing contacts, organisations, lists, and activities between HubSpot and other connected systems.

Spotler Connect allows you to synchronise and transform data such as contacts, orders, or activities between external systems, even if no direct integration is available between them. Connect gathers your data, saves it in your account environment, and changes the format before exporting it to other systems if necessary. By doing this continuously for all connectors in your account, the software can maintain a complete overview of your data in different systems and keep it in sync.

In Connect, you can add account-wide or integration-specific rules to modify data based on conditions, block import or export, or add actions when a condition is met. These rules allow you to customise data being handled in a way that works for external systems—for example, when you want to synchronise mailing opt-ins, activities, or orders.

Which HubSpot versions are supported?

The Spotler Connect integration supports the following HubSpot products:

  • HubSpot Marketing Hub Enterprise
  • HubSpot Sales Hub Enterprise
  • HubSpot Service Hub Enterprise
  • HubSpot Content Hub Enterprise

HubSpot Professional products are supported with limited functionality. Some features, such as synchronization of certain digital activities, depend on API availability in your HubSpot environment.

How are organisations synchronized?

HubSpot organisations are synchronized with Spotler Connect. When an organisation is created or updated in HubSpot, a corresponding profile is created or updated in Spotler Connect. Changes from other connected systems can also update existing organisations.

The following fields are mapped by default, when available in HubSpot:

companyName, description, domain, phone, street, housenumber, housenumberExtension, city, zipCode, region, country

Additional fields can be mapped to organisation meta fields in Spotler Connect.

How are contacts synchronized?

HubSpot contacts are synchronized with Spotler Connect. When a contact is created or updated in HubSpot, a corresponding profile is created or updated in Spotler Connect. Changes from other connected systems can also update existing contacts.

The following fields are mapped by default, when available in HubSpot:

firstName, lastName, email, gender, phone, street, housenumber, housenumberExtension, city, zipCode, region, country, marketing preferences

Additional fields can be mapped to contact meta fields in Spotler Connect, including fields from related records when configured.

Permissions such as opt-ins for different types of communication are matched with HubSpot communication subscriptions by name. If names do not match, you can configure a data rule in Spotler Connect or align naming between systems.

How are contact lists synchronized?

Contact lists in Spotler Connect are synchronized with HubSpot as marketing lists. Lists can originate from other systems connected to Spotler Connect, such as a customer data platform.

Lists are updated when contacts are added or removed. You can control which lists are synchronized by enabling the Sync to Spotler property in HubSpot.

How are digital activities synchronized?

Digital activities from systems connected to Spotler Connect can be synchronized to HubSpot. These activities support follow-up actions, customer insights, and segmentation.

Examples of digital activities include:

  • Automation was triggered
  • Page view
  • Email was sent
  • Email was opened
  • Email link was clicked
  • Email was bounced
  • Was invited to event
  • Will attend event
  • Will not attend event
  • Has attended event
  • Has not attended event
  • Was added to list
  • Was removed from list
  • Form was submitted
  • Purchase
  • SMS was sent
  • SMS was bounced

When a deal is created in HubSpot, it is synchronized to Spotler Connect as a digital activity.
